Basic Information

Product Name 6-Fluoro-3-Iodo-4-Indazolecarboxylic Acid Methyl Ester
CAS No. 885521-81-3
Molecular Formula C9H6FINO2
Molecular Weight 321.06 g/mol
Synonyms Methyl 6-Fluoro-3-Iodo-1H-Indazole-4-Carboxylate; 6-Fluoro-3-Iodo-1H-Indazole-4-Carboxylic Acid Methyl Ester; 4-Indazolecarboxylic Acid, 6-Fluoro-3-Iodo-, Methyl Ester; 1H-Indazole-4-carboxylic acid, 6-fluoro-3-iodo-, methyl ester; 885521-81-3; 6-Fluoro-3-iodoindazole-4-carboxylic acid methyl ester

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at a controlled room temperature (typically 15-25°C). Keep the container sealed to protect this light-sensitive material from degradation.
